SYSTEMS, APPARATUS, AND METHODS FOR TREATMENT OF VARICOCELE AND ASSOCIATED CONDITIONS
Systems, apparatus, and methods are described for treatment of varicocele and associated conditions. In some embodiments, systems, apparatus, and methods described herein can include forming one or more fluid connections or fistulas between blood vessels such as a gonadal vein (e.g., spermatic vein, ovarian vein) and surrounding veins. In some embodiments, systems, apparatus, and methods described herein can include occluding one or more blood vessels such as a gonadal vein (e.g., spermatic vein, ovarian vein). In some embodiments, systems, apparatus and methods described herein relate to flow diverters, replacement valves, etc., e.g., for treatment of varicocele and associated conditions.
Posterior to lateral interbody fusion approach with associated instrumentation and implants
Methods for accessing a disc space of a patient as a part of an interbody fusion, as well as the tools employed therewith. An exemplary method may include inserting a leading end of a tool into the patient's back at a location on the posterior surface that is laterally offset from a patient's spinous process and disc. The tool's initial entry into the patient may be from a posterior approach. As the tool is advanced along its designated path, it begins to deviate from the posterior approach towards a lateral approach. When the leading end reaches the disc, it may access the disc from a lateral or substantially lateral location. The tool may be used to access the disc location, to remove disc material, to deliver a cutting tool for removing the disc material, and other steps associated with the spinal interbody fusion procedure.

Endoscopic snare device
The present subject matter discloses a tissue removal tool for use with an endoscope. The tool comprises a loop formed by a piece of wire and movable between an open position and a closed position, and a transmitting assembly comprising: a handle; and a link having a first end attached to the handle and a second end attached to the loop, the loop portion being movable between the open and closed position by action of the handle. The loop is defined in the open position by a proximal portion and a distal portion. The widest portion of the loop is more proximal to a proximal end of the loop than the mid-point of the length of the loop is.
SURGICAL INSTRUMENT WITH A LOOP MADE OF A METAL WIRE
A surgical instrument with a shaft is constructed as a hollow tube and has a longitudinal axis, proximal and distal ends and a metal wire having a first end section, a shaft section and a working section. The first end section is arranged in the area of the proximal end of the shaft or is guided out of the shaft on the proximal end. The shaft section is guided in the hollow tube and the wire is arranged such that it can move along the longitudinal axis of the shaft into a first position of the working section on the distal end projecting out of the shaft and into a second position of the working section within the shaft. The instrument is constructed as a bipolar instrument, wherein the metal wire is part of a first electrode and a second electrode is arranged in some sections on the shaft.
MAGNET-ASSISTED SUTURE GRASPERS
A magnet-assisted suture grasper for grasping a magnetic suture is provided. The magnet-assisted suture grasper includes a suture retrieval needle, a retriever body, a grasper arm, and a grasper magnet. Translation of the retriever body within a needle lumen of the suture retrieval needle in a first direction causes the grasper arm to move from a first position to a second position, thereby exposing the grasper magnet and allowing contact between the grasper magnet and a magnetic suture attracted thereto. Translation of the retriever body within the needle lumen in a second direction opposite the first direction causes the grasper arm to move from the second position to the first position, thereby sequestering the grasper magnet and grasping the magnetic suture within the needle lumen. Another magnet-assisted suture grasper including a handle, a stem, first and second grasper jaws, a grasper magnet, and an actuator body also is disclosed.
MEDICAL APPARATUS WITH EMBEDDED MARKING
A medical apparatus configured for insertion directly or indirectly into a living body is provided with a coloring part having a marking formed on an outer surface. The marking has a coloring layer of an acrylic resin containing a pigment and a protective layer of a polymethacrylic ester covering the coloring layer directly or indirectly, and an upper surface of the coloring part is recessed from a part of the medical apparatus, such as a covering tube of a sheath of an endoscope treatment instrument, adjacent to the coloring part on the outer surface.
HEMOSTATIC CLIP WITH NEEDLE PASSER
A device for treating a tissue opening includes a proximal portion including an elongated flexible member, a capsule releasably coupled to a distal end of the flexible member and including a lumen extending therethrough and a clip including a pair of arms movably housed within the capsule. A suture extending along a first one of the pair of arms and including a loop at a distal end thereof extending across an opening extending through the first one of the pair of arms. A suture grabbing element extending laterally from a second one of the pair of arms and including a hook so that, when the pair of arms are moved toward a closed configuration, the hook extends through the opening to grab the loop and draw the distal end of the suture from the first one of the pair of arms toward the second one of the pair of arms.
SNARE FOR REMOVAL OF IMPLANTED CARDIAC LEADS
The present disclosure relates generally to medical devices and the use of medical devices for the treatment of vascular conditions. Particularly, the present disclosure provides devices and methods for using a snaring system to remove an implanted lead from the vasculature. A snaring system comprises an outer sheath (710) having a lumen; an inner sheath (705); a pusher (745) disposed within the lumen of the sheath, wherein the pusher comprises a longitudinal axis; a closed loop (720) having an opening, wherein the closed loop comprises a proximal extended portion, an S-curve portion and a distal extended portion, wherein the proximal extended portion of the closed loop is coupled to the pusher, wherein the proximal extended portion is substantially parallel to the longitudinal axis to the pusher, wherein the pusher and the closed loop are slidable relative to the inner sheath, whereupon being in a deployed configuration, the closed loop is disposed distally of the sheath and the S-curve portion is disposed substantially perpendicular to the proximal extended portion, wherein the S-curve portion comprises a first radius and a second radius, wherein the first radius is closer to the proximal extended portion relative to the distal extended portion, wherein the second radius is closer to the distal extended portion relative to the proximal extended portion, wherein the first radius is greater than the second radius; and a threader (725) fixedly coupled to the inner sheath, whereupon the closed loop being pulled proximally, the closed loop collapses over the threader and the threader is disposed within the opening of the closed loop. In one embodiment, two opposing closed loops are provided.
